About P. Holm
P. Holm is a scholar working on Reproductive Medicine,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Agronomy and Crop Science, Genetics and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, having authored 101 papers that have together received 5.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Reproductive Biology and Fertility (55 papers), Animal Genetics and Reproduction (20 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(14 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(8 papers), Pluripotent Stem Cells Research (7 papers), Bioenergy crop production and management (7 papers), Prenatal Screening and Diagnostics (6 papers) and Ovarian function and disorders (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Reproductive Medicine (2.0k citations),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(3.5k citations), Agronomy and Crop Science (640 citations), Genetics (1.2k citations) and Molecular Biology (2.3k citations). P. Holm has collaborated with scholars based in Denmark, Australia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Henrik Callesen, T. Greve, P.J. Booth, Gábor Vajta, Diter von Wettstein, Søren W. Rasmussen, Mette Schmidt, H. Jacobsen, M. Kuwayama and Per L. Gregersen. Their work appears in journals such as Theriogenology, Reproduction Fertility and Development, Acta veterinaria Scandinavica, Biology of Reproduction and Animal Reproduction Science.
